Output 3a0fe1bf20e1c79ed74bfcfb37b361001df839a13b4741eb658fe7e29bcff96d:51

value
12406500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b34cd57910536f27898e4cd5b85a5f7002d1bc18 OP_EQUAL
address
3J34vPjsKK66UStyqYwibea4P1uVYbwb9W
transaction
3a0fe1bf20e1c79ed74bfcfb37b361001df839a13b4741eb658fe7e29bcff96d
confirmations
224868
spent
true